> I think this patch is incorrect, because you do not install a separate
> address space for each CPU. Also, the CPU address space is only used
> with TCG so it should be guarded by "if (tcg_enabled())".
Don't we need it be mapped on for KVM for MSI to work
when using kvm-apic?
kvm_apic_io_ops->write = kvm_apic_mem_write->kvm_irqchip_send_msi()
